A Zork I game ported from ZIL source to Golang.
Description
Zork I is a 1980 interactive fiction game written by Marc Blank, Dave Lebling, Bruce Daniels and Tim Anderson and published by Infocom. To learn more about the history of the game feel free to read Zork I: The Great Underground Empire on Medium.

Project structure
gozork/
engine/ # Reusable text-adventure engine (parser, objects, clock, I/O)
game/ # Zork I game content (rooms, items, NPCs, action handlers)
main.go # Entry point
